Hey — handover notes on role-based access for the Fernwick wiki before I rotate off.

Roles live in the Gatehouse service; the wiki just asks it "can X do Y on page Z." Don't hardcode role names anywhere — use the capability constants. The tricky bit is inherited permissions on moved pages; there's a nightly reconciler that fixes drift, so don't panic if things look stale for a few hours. Any questions on the reconciler, ask the person below.

named custodian: Belius Casath Ulaix Sorius

Welcome aboard! You'll mostly be working on PortionPal, our recipe-scaling calculator. The math lives in scaler/core — unit conversions, yield adjustments, the works. Don't touch the rounding rules without pinging Dalia first; bakers get cranky about grams. Local setup is just one make command, honestly pretty painless. To run the integration suite against the internal ingredient-data service, you'll need the key below.

app token of yajeg-kawef = kto11_7En3XSX8xQw

TURN-208: Gatevale turnstile counters at the Merrow Field pilot double-count when a rotation reverses mid-cycle. Attendance totals drift roughly 2% high per event. The debounce window fix is implemented, reviewed by Ilsa, and soak-tested across two simulated match days without drift. Ready for your cut; the candidate build is identified below.

trace token, tagag-tafog: htk6_5ed18c

Handing off the Quillbus broker upgrade (4.x to 5.1) to Dario. Cluster is half-migrated; mixed-version mode is supported but TLS cert rotation must finish before cutover. No auth model changes, though the admin API gained two new endpoints worth reviewing. Open questions and the migration checklist are tracked on the internal page below.

dashboard of taduf-bawef = https://jira.lumicsys.internal/projects/display/browse/b1cbf89d